Output 84fe990b53160ecb3983bde3fde2a529484106edb4eb25bd68f8c51a006ccca4:0

value
489733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 501e2b6b6e67e56491257ee3e4d204a546e4bdcc OP_EQUAL
address
38ze87QfzkNybx1UEimPV7eEtFvmpp3Ztp
transaction
84fe990b53160ecb3983bde3fde2a529484106edb4eb25bd68f8c51a006ccca4
spent
true